In our view, one of the biggest weaknesses of the current system is the absence of the interpretation of research findings to help inform decision-making and actions at all levels. It is not easy to articulate a solution to this issue succinctly, as effective mediation depends crucially on the context, the nature of the research and the knowledge of the practitioner or policy-maker, but it lies at the heart of a system that effectively integrates research, development, policy formation, implementation and reflective practice.
